About

Vincent Tropepe is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Developmental Neuroscience and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Vincent Tropepe has authored 46 papers receiving a total of 5.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 39 papers in Molecular Biology, 21 papers in Developmental Neuroscience and 19 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Vincent Tropepe’s work include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(21 papers), Zebrafish Biomedical Research Applications (19 papers) and Retinal Development and Disorders (12 papers). Vincent Tropepe is often cited by papers focused on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(21 papers), Zebrafish Biomedical Research Applications (19 papers) and Retinal Development and Disorders (12 papers). Vincent Tropepe coll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and Australia. Vincent Tropepe's co-authors include Derek van der Kooy, Bernard J. Chiasson, Janet Rossant, Cindi M. Morshead, Seiji Hitoshi, Andrew Elia, Tak W. Mak, Benjamin W. Lindsey, Roderick R. McInnes and Brenda L.K. Coles and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Neuron.
